"Let me be clear": Greenland's Prime Minister sets the tone in response to Trump's threats

The American president has shown renewed interest in taking control of the Arctic territory — even suggesting that a military intervention was "not off the table". An intervention that did not sit well at all with Greenland's Prime Minister, Jens-Frederik Nielsen.

Speaking out on social media, Nielsen reacted strongly to Trump's statements, emphasising that Greenland's sovereignty is not negotiable.

"President Trump claims that the United States will 'obtain Greenland'. Let me be clear: the United States is not getting it. We belong to no one else. We determine our own future. We must not act out of fear. We must respond with peace, dignity, and unity. And it is through these values that we must clearly, clearly, and calmly show the American president that Greenland is ours. It was like this yesterday. It is like this today. And it is how it will be in the future." wrote Nielsen .
